RTSP 是 Internet 协议规范,是 TCPIP 协议体系中的一个应用层协议级网络通信系统。专为娱乐(如音频和视频)和通信系统的使用,以控制流媒体服务器。该协议用于在端点之间建立和控制媒体会话。媒体服务器的客户端发出 VHS 样式的命令,例如:PLAY、PAUSE、SETUP、DESCRIBE、RECORD 等等。以促进对从服务器到客户端或从客户端到 …
1、 前言互联网上关于RTSP的文章很多,但是大多数都是抽象的理论介绍,本文将从实际例子解说RTSP协议,不求面面俱到,但求简单易懂。RTSP(Real-Time Streaming Protocol)实时流式协议是IETF的MMUSIC工作组开发的协议,现在已成为因特网建议标准[RFC 2326]。RTSP是为了给流式过程增加更多的功能(暂停、继续、播放、 …
4G物联网网关基于嵌入式linux系统开发,可接支持ONVIF协议的网络摄像头或NVR,提供RTSP转发、RTMP推流、ONVIF云台控制、NVR录像回放等功能,支持HTML5页面无插件播放,提供sdk接口文档。4G物联网网关主要功能硬件启动会使用onvif协议,udp广播,搜索摄像头或NVR。每次推流,后台都可以分配一个流媒体服务器,应对高并发。可选通道的 …
厚积薄发,在经过一年多积攒之后,Nmap官方最近发布了一个新的Npcap 1.00版本,紧接着发布了Nmap 7.9版本。 这是自从2019 Defcon极客大会后Nmap发布的第一个新版本。此期间官方立足于其底层软件Npcap的开发,总共发布了16个Npcap版本,使其成为一个稳定的线上高性能版本1.00,以此为基础打造Nmap多平台下共体验的平台。概述除 …
在互联网大厂的后端开发工作场景中,不少开发人员都面临过这样的实际需求:项目需要将 RTSP 数据流进行格式转换,以适配不同系统的使用要求 。尽管查阅了大量资料,尝试多种方法,问题却依旧悬而未决。实际上,在 Spring Boot 框架中实现 RTSP 数据流转换,是有迹可循的,接下来就为大家详细讲解。RTSP,全称 Real Time Streaming P …
本文将手把手教你用纯C#代码实现工业级RTSP流媒体播放器,0第三方播放控件,CPU占用率降低70%,延迟控制在200ms以内!全程干货,代码可直接用于生产环境。一、为什么选择FFmpeg+WriteableBitmap方案?传统方案的痛点VLC等控件体积臃肿DirectShow延迟不可控WinForm控件性能瓶颈我们的技术优势FFmpeg原生解码(版本4. …
RTSP(Real-Time Streaming Protocol,实时流协议) 采用CS(客户端服务器)架构,是一种专为实时媒体流控制设计的,用于控制媒体流的如播放、暂停、定位等,广泛应用于视频监控、直播、视频会议等场景。RTSP协议的控制方法关键字包括"OPTIONS","DESCRIBE","SETUP" …
设备:360智能摄像机红色警戒标准版(型号:AW2L)TP-link网络录像机,NVR(型号:TL-NVR6108PX ) 去年买了好几个360摄像头,来来回回只能在手机上使用,时间久了觉得有点不方便,就想连接网络录像机接个显示器使用。就在网络上查资料,查来查去好像360都不支持NVL,只能打开电脑登录网页查看。不过还好我买的这款刚好支持通用协议onvif。 …
RTSP流媒体数据传输的两种方式(TCP和UDP)1.传输协议通常情况下rtsp协议中数据传输的实现是UDP,因工作需要,想让rtsp的数据传输部分用TCP实现。1.1 RTSP - RTP over UDP要使用UDP连接,RTSP客户端需要在SETUP阶段请求UDP连接。SETUP命令中应该包括如下格式的Transport:Transport: RTPA …
0.引言本文主要讲解如何搭建RTSP流媒体服务器的过程,使用开源项目ZLMediaKit。通过这个开源项目,推RTSP流到服务器,然后拉流端可以拉取RTSP、RTMP等流。ZLMediaKit码云链接:https:gitee.comxia-chuZLMediaKitZLMediaKit的github链接:https:github.comxiongzilian …